The united state can release 10,000 EB-5 capitalist visas each year. These visas are offered for experts that fulfill the rigorous qualification requirements of the program. A foreign professional may be eligible for the EB-5 financier program if they invest in a new company that was developed after November 29, 1990, or, if developed before that day, was reorganized, restructured, or increased.
Requesting the EB-5 capitalist program requires care. A complete strategy to ensure all supporting paperwork, types, and declaring costs are sent is essential to preventing delays and denials. After discovering a financial investment program and investing, a capitalist will certainly require to: Submit Kind I-526 with United State Citizenship and Migration Provider (USCIS) Wait for USCIS approval Pay all declaring costs and send to the National Visa Facility (NVC) Participate in a meeting at the united state
